Selecting the Right Bucket Hat for Your Face Shape
How does one choose the right bucket hat to flatter their face shape? Recognizing the correlation between face shape and hat style is crucial for obtaining a flattering look. For round faces, hats with a elevated crown and a broader brim can establish balance by lengthening the face. Those with square faces may do well with rounded hats that minimize angular features, while oval faces are versatile, supporting different styles without diminishing aesthetics.
When it comes to heart-shaped faces, bucket hats with a medium brim can draw attention away from the forehead. Meanwhile, people with long faces should opt for hats with a shorter replay bucket hat crown and wider brim to create breadth. In the end, choosing the right bucket hat requires attention to face shape to complement facial features and achieve a balanced appearance. Materials and Patterns to Think About for Bucket Hats
Selecting the right materials and patterns for bucket hats can significantly enhance both style and functionality. Common materials include cotton, denim, and nylon, each offering unique benefits. Cotton is breathable and easy to wear, making it perfect for warm weather, while denim provides durability with a casual look. Nylon, on the other hand, is water-resistant and lightweight, ideal for outdoor activities.
With regard to patterns, the options are nearly infinite. Timeless solid colors offer versatility, while vibrant prints such as florals, stripes, or tie-dye can make a fashion statement. Camouflage patterns appeal to those looking for a rugged style, while graphic designs cater to a more artistic crowd.

How Can I Clean My Bucket Hat?
For cleaning a bucket hat, hand-wash it gently in cold water with gentle detergent. Never wring the hat, rather, pat it dry with a towel and reshape before air-drying away from direct sunlight to preserve its shape.
Can You Wear Bucket Hats in Winter?
Bucket hats can be suitable for winter if made from warm materials like wool or fleece. That said, their efficiency mostly relies on the particular design and insulation qualities, meaning some are more fitting for cold weather than others.
